Qualifications

RS&H is currently seeking an Aviation Engineering Intern to join our team. This position will work in-office. As part of the Aviation Infrastructure team, you'll gain great experience on a variety of conventional and design-build projects that combine innovative design with a strong knowledge of technical standards to exceed client expectations and provide cost-effective solutions.

To be successful in this internship, you must:

  • Current student pursuing a Bachelor or Master’s degree in Civil Engineering at an ABET accredited university with at least 1 year remaining until program completion
  • 2.5 GPA or above
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ills
  • Ability to work on multiple assignments simultaneously
  • Ability to work independently as well as part of a team environment

Preferred Qualifications:

  • Prior internship or related experience
  • Experience with AutoCAD/AutoCAD Civil 3D
  • Experience or exposure to Federal Aviation Administration (FAA) Advisory Circulars
  • Specific interest in Aviation Infrastructure
